Purpose

To
support the recommendations for an award of contract to the
preferred tenderer for the delivery of key service in ensuring
safety of residents and compliance with legislation and
Council’s policy.
Award of Fire Risk Assessor contract to deliver quality Fire
Risk Assessments to Council properties, and provision of impartial
advice on report findings, aimed to support the varied needs of the
property portfolios for housing, corporate and school buildings.
Whilst ensuring it meets the Council’s ongoing requirements
to comply with the Regulatory Reform (Fire Safety) Order 2005, Fire
Safety Act 2021, Fire Safety (England) Regulations 2022.
 
The
delivery of this service will align with the Council’s Fire
Safety Policy which states:
•          
Ensuring properties containing Council homes have current Fire Risk
Assessments with all recommendations actioned (e.g., covering
communal areas, etc.)
•          
Ensuring Fire risk assessments are reviewed following significant
changes or any fire events in properties containing Council
homes.
 

Content

For the reasons given in the
report, the Corporate Director of Housing
AGREED to
:
 
 
Approve the award  of a contract for
delivery Fire Risk Assessment for a period of three years (with a
possible extension for a further two years) a maximum period of 5
years with a value set out in the Part B report.
